Facts of the Case
Background
The appellant, RioZim (Private) Limited, sought to interdict respondents from mining on Wendale 43 Block mining claims registered in its name since 1974. The respondents claimed title through a special grant from the Ministry of Mines. The High Court dismissed the application finding a material dispute of fact. The Supreme Court allowed the appeal, finding no genuine dispute of fact.
